[Bug 257531] isoinfo response
without format options, very bad result: isoinfo -l -i ubuntu-8.04.1-server-i386.iso | grep -e nic_restricted_fir -- 000 764 Jun 27 2008 [ 38927 00] nic_restricted_firmware_2_.;1 with -R (Rock Ridge extensions) (good for linux file system!), it's ok! isoinfo -l -R -i ubuntu-8.04.1-server-i386.iso | grep -e nic-restricted-firmware-2.6.24-19 -r--r--r-- 1000 764 Jun 27 2008 [ 38927 00] nic-restricted-firmware-2.6.24-19-generic-di_2.6.24.13-19.44_i386.udeb with -J (Joliet extensions), ooops... some char are missing isoinfo -l -J -i ubuntu-8.04.1-server-i386.iso | grep -e nic-restricted-firmware-2.6.24-19 -- 000 764 Jun 27 2008 [ 38927 00] nic-restricted-firmware-2.6.24-19-generic-di_2.6.24.13-19.44_i38 using -R and -J together give badly Joliet result... to but we can get info from here: isoinfo -d -i ubuntu-8.04.1-server-i386.iso| grep Rock Ridge Rock Ridge signatures version 1 found so use -R and if not -R try with that: isoinfo -d -i ubuntu-8.04.1-server-i386.iso| grep Joliet Joliet with UCS level 3 found in order to use -J Paul -- bad file names (truncated) in iso images https://bugs.launchpad.net/bugs/257531 You received this bug notification because you are a member of Ubuntu Desktop Bugs, which is subscribed to file-roller in ubuntu. -- desktop-bugs mailing list desktop-bugs@lists.ubuntu.com https://lists.ubuntu.com/mailman/listinfo/desktop-bugs
